Franz Wagner leads Magic past Spurs, who get 30-point second half from Devin Vassell
Franz Wagner scored 34 points and the Orlando Magic weathered a 30-point second half by San Antonio's Devin Vassell to beat the Spurs 127-111 on Thursday night. After going scoreless in the first half, Vassell hit all nine of his shots in a 23-point third quarter, helping the Spurs get within 10 points after trailing by 23. Coach Gregg Popovich spoke to Vassell at halftime and urged him to play more aggressively.
